    @engar-dug5197 4 месяца назад +19

    The crazy thing is that the minutes that Tatum's on/off for this playoff is the 2nd best for the team behind Jrue Holiday at this moment. The Celtics average a +13 net rating when he's playing, and only +3.5 when he's sitting. At a certain point you have to acknowledge that even if his shots not falling, there is so much else that's happening on the court because of his presence--Gravity, playmaking, defense, ect. These on-off numbers are absolutely FLIPPED if you look at guys like Brown and White. Maybe it's not the most glamorous way to win a championship but the scoreboard don't lie.
    Also, I hate the "He only plays well in the 2nd half when the team is already up by 15". As if we didn't just watch the Timberwolves, down 20, absolutely route the Nuggets in the 2nd half to win game 7. Every minute counts until the opposing team throws in the towel.

    @boussie 4 месяца назад +5

    I think the thing about Tatum not having signature moments translates more to not having signature highlights. He has plenty of signature games, but that’s not what Twitter is gonna see on their timeline outside of a box score. Game 6 vs. the bucks down 3-2 when he dropped 46, game 7 vs. Philly with 51, game 6 vs. Philly when he outscored them in the 4th after having a stinker. He’s got plenty of great performances, just not single clips that the casual fan can latch onto
